Dried Oregano vs Dried Parsley

We scientifically analyze the biological properties of Dried Oregano and Dried Parsley. Review the differences in macronutrients, vitamins, minerals, and our final nutritional verdict.

Nutrient / MetricDried Oregano (100g)Dried Parsley (100g)
Calories265 kcal 292 kcal
Protein9g 25g
Fats7g 7g
Carbohydrates68g 51g
Dietary Fiber42g 41g
GIGlycemic Index0 0
Water Content8% 8%

Dried Oregano

Dried oregano is a popular herb known for its aromatic flavor and numerous health benefits. It is rich in antioxidants and has anti-inflammatory properties.

Dried oregano is high in antioxidants, which help combat oxidative stress and may reduce the risk of chronic diseases.
It possesses anti-inflammatory properties that can help alleviate symptoms of inflammatory conditions.

Dried Parsley

Dried parsley is a concentrated form of the fresh herb, retaining many of its nutrients and flavor. It is commonly used as a seasoning and garnish in various cuisines.

Rich in vitamins A, C, and K, dried parsley supports immune function and skin health.
Contains antioxidants that help combat oxidative stress and inflammation.
